1. A subcutaneous access port catheter assembly comprising:

  • a flexible catheter, said catheter having distal and proximal ends and having an inner wall portion defined by a pretensioned, continuous helical coil and an outer sheathing formed from a tube of smooth, inert flexible plastic material, wherein said sheath is in intimate contact with the outer spiral of said coil; and

    an elongated puncture needle having a sharp point at the distal end and a knob member at the proximal end, said puncture needle being inserted coaxially down the length of said catheter such that the sharp point at the distal end of the elongated puncture needle extends beyond the distal end of said catheter,wherein the assembly has sufficient rigidity to penetrate a septum which has a Shore A durometer of at least 25 and wherein said elongated puncture needle can be removed from said catheter.
